数据库软件VisualFoxpro课件第四章表的操作.ppt
《数据库软件VisualFoxpro课件第四章表的操作.ppt》由会员分享,可在线阅读,更多相关《数据库软件VisualFoxpro课件第四章表的操作.ppt(20页珍藏版)》请在三一办公上搜索。
1、1,第四章 表操作 4.1 表操作,数据表由结构和数据组成,表4-1 学生情况表,2,1.数据表的结构 所谓建立表结构就是定义各个字段的属性,基本的字段属性可包括字段名、字段类型、字段宽度和小数位数等。字段名:用来标识字段,它是以一个字母或汉字开头,长度 不超过10的字母、汉字、数字、下划线序列 例:下列字段名写法正确的是 Student_id _xingming 学号1 姓名*类型与宽度:字段类型、宽度及小数位数等属性用来描述字 段值。类型指字段值数据类型;宽度规定了字 段存储的最大字节数,表4-2 字段类型与宽度,注:日期型宽度为8,逻辑型宽度为1,备注型和通用型字段 宽度都为4,它们的宽
2、度是固定不变的小数位数:只有数值型与浮点型字段才有小数位数,4,建立表的结构菜单方式命令方式:create 注:以上两种方式都使用了表设计器设置默认目录命令:set default to 路径create table(,),)功能:建立一个由表示的表,表中含有指定的字段例:create table stud(学号 c(8),姓名 c(8),性别 c(2),出生日期 d,;专业号 c(2),入校总分 n(6,2),团员 l,简历 m,照片 g)表数据的输入4.2 表的打开和关闭打开表菜单方式命令方式:use 路径,5,表的浏览与表数据的添加关闭表命令1:use 功能:关闭当前工作区已打开的表文件
3、命令2:close tables all 功能:关闭所有的表文件命令3:close all 功能:关闭所有工作区中所有各类型文件,包括表文件4.3 表结构的修改利用表设计器修改表菜单方式命令方式:modify structure利用表向导修改表结构,6,4.4 表的记录定位和显示记录的定位记录指针的绝对定位 命令:go|goto|top|bottom 例:use stud?recno()go 4?recno()go bottom?recno()go top?recno()记录指针的相对定位,7,skip 功能:从当前记录开始移动记录指针,表示 移动记录的个数 例:use stud?recno(
4、),bof()skip-1?recno(),bof()&记录号仍然为1 skip 8?recno(),bof()skip?recno(),eof()skip?recno(),eof()&记录号为11 注意:数值表达式若为负值表示向文件头移位,若缺省默 认为1,8,记录的显示list命令 命令格式:list|display fieldsforwhileoff 功能:在表中按指定范围与条件筛选出记录并显示出来 说明:范围子句:4种限定方法 all 所有记录 next 从当前记录起的n个记录 record 第n个记录 rest 从当前记录起到最后一个记录止的所有记录 注:缺省范围子句默认为all;而
5、display命令默认为当前记录for 子句:其中为逻辑表达式,表示筛选出符合 条件的记录 例:use stud go 2 list next 5 for 入校总分=575,9,while子句:也用于指明筛选条件,从当前符合条件的记录开 始筛选,遇到不满足条件的记录时就结束 例:use stud go 5 list next 5 while 入校总分=520fields子句:确定要进行操作的字段。保留字fields可以省 略,表达式表列出需要操作的字段;若 fields子句 省略,则显示除备注型、通用型字段外的所有字段 例:use stud list list record 6 fields
6、学号,姓名,入校总分off:不显示记录号例:要求:1)显示第3个到第5个之间男生记录 2)列出入校总分高于520的非团员或者在以后出生的团员,只列出学号,姓名,入校总分,团员,10,关系运算选择:从关系中找出满足条件的记录 投影:从关系中选取若干属性(字段)组成新的关系联接:是对两个关系通过共同的属性名(字段名)进行投影 操作来联接生成一个新的关系,11,浏览窗口显示记录 命令:browse fields for 功能:打开浏览窗口,显示、浏览和修改记录数据例:use stud brow fields 学号,姓名,入校总分,团员 for 团员命令和子句的书写规则各子句的次序允许任意排列,命令与
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 数据库 软件 VisualFoxpro 课件 第四 操作

链接地址:https://www.31ppt.com/p-5985862.html